[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]How much do you help your HS kids with their school work? Is your kid very independent and does not require any help from you? Do you sit with your high schooler and help them with their home work or unfinished class work?[/quote] None really. I proof some of the written stuff. But otherwise I offer only to get a tutor, as needed [/quote] +1 Same for us. And not because I don't care. I care deeply. For one, I can't help with a lot of it. Secondly, my son has never received help from me very well, many kids are like that. Thirdly, I'm trying to prepare him for college and life where you have to self-advocate. Barring a disability of some kind, IMHO, a high school student should be learning to handle academics on their own.[/quote]
